吉隆坡服务器性能全解析:延迟、带宽与优化实战

在面向东南亚、尤其是马来西亚市场部署业务时,选择合适的吉隆坡服务器并对其网络与系统进行深度优化,是确保用户体验与成本效益的关键。本文从网络原理、性能指标、实测工具与优化实战多个层面解析吉隆坡服务器的延迟与带宽表现,并与香港服务器、美国服务器、日本服务器、韩国服务器、新加坡服务器等常见节点进行对比,给出面向站长、企业用户与开发者的选购与调优建议。

延迟与带宽的基本原理

理解服务器性能,首先要区分延迟(latency)带宽(bandwidth)这两个概念。延迟指从发送端到接收端第一个比特抵达所需的时间,受物理距离、路由跳数、链路质量、MTU与队列延迟影响;带宽则表示单位时间内可以传输的数据量,受链路容量、接口速率(如1Gbps、10Gbps)、服务计费策略与拥塞控制算法限制。

在 TCP/IP 传输中,二者共同决定吞吐量:TCP 的吞吐量近似由公式 Bandwidth-Delay Product (BDP) 决定,即吞吐量 ≈ 窗口大小 / RTT。若 RTT 较高但 TCP 窗口设置不足,实际带宽利用率会很低。因此在远端部署(例如从中国大陆访问吉隆坡或美国)时,必须通过内核调参或采用拥塞控制算法来提升利用率。

常见影响因素

  • 物理距离与海缆路径:从中国/香港/新加坡到吉隆坡通常较短,延迟低于美欧节点;而美国服务器到吉隆坡的 RTT 显著更高。
  • 网络互联与对等(peering):优质的 IX(Internet Exchange)互联能显著降低跳数和中转延迟,影响比选择机房本身更大。
  • 链路抖动与丢包率:高丢包会触发 TCP 重传,严重降低有效带宽。
  • MTU 与分片:不合理的 MTU 设置会导致分片与延迟。
  • 服务器硬件与虚拟化开销:香港VPS 与吉隆坡的物理服务器在 I/O 延迟与网络栈性能上差异明显。

吉隆坡服务器的典型应用场景

吉隆坡(Kuala Lumpur)作为东南亚的网络枢纽之一,适合以下业务:

  • 区域性站点与电商:针对马来西亚、印尼、菲律宾、泰国用户,吉隆坡能提供较低的访问延迟。
  • 移动应用后台服务:移动端请求延迟敏感,分布在吉隆坡的后端可降低首包时间。
  • 跨国混合架构:与香港服务器、新加坡服务器或日本服务器形成多点部署,实现灾备与就近访问。
  • 媒体分发与直播边缘:结合 CDN 能把大流量卸载到边缘节点,吉隆坡用于动态请求处理效果好。

性能测量工具与评估方法

要做精确优化,首先需要量化问题。常用工具包括:

  • ping:测 RTT 与丢包,适合快速检查连通性。
  • traceroute / mtr:诊断路由路径与中间跳延迟。
  • iperf3:测试 TCP/UDP 带宽与吞吐极限。
  • netperf:评估协议级别吞吐和延迟。
  • fio:磁盘 I/O 性能(影响动态页面与数据库响应)。
  • 系统监控:htop、iostat、sar、vnstat 用于定位 CPU、IO、网络瓶颈。

实测建议覆盖不同时间段(高峰/非高峰)、不同并发连接数与不同数据包大小,以还原真实流量特性。

常见瓶颈与操作系统层优化

在 Linux 上,网络瓶颈往往可以通过内核参数调整缓解。典型优化项包括:

  • 增加 TCP 缓冲区:
    • net.core.rmem_max、net.core.wmem_max:增大单连接读写缓冲上限。
    • net.ipv4.tcp_rmem、net.ipv4.tcp_wmem:设置自动增长范围以适配高 BDP 环境。
  • 启用拥塞控制算法:将 net.ipv4.tcp_congestion_control 设置为 bcc/bbr(BBR 在高 RTT/高带宽链路下能显著提升吞吐)。
  • 减少 TIME_WAIT 问题:tcp_tw_reuse、tcp_tw_recycle(注意兼容性),适用于高并发短连接场景。
  • 优化连接队列:net.core.somaxconn 与 net.ipv4.tcp_max_syn_backlog,防止 SYN 洪泛与连接拒绝。
  • 使用 fq_codel 或 cake 作为 qdisc:减少队列延迟、抑制 bufferbloat,改善交互延迟。
  • 调整 MTU 与支持 Jumbo Frames:在数据中心内部网可以提高吞吐,但需确保端到端路径支持。

示例 sysctl 配置片段(仅供参考,实际需按环境调整):

net.core.rmem_max=134217728
net.core.wmem_max=134217728
net.ipv4.tcp_rmem=4096 87380 134217728
net.ipv4.tcp_wmem=4096 65536 134217728
net.ipv4.tcp_congestion_control=bbr
net.core.netdev_max_backlog=250000
net.ipv4.tcp_mtu_probing=1

存储与 I/O 对延迟的影响

网页响应与数据库查询不仅受网络影响,磁盘 I/O 延迟同样关键。对于 MySQL、PostgreSQL、Elasticsearch 等系统需注意:

  • 使用 NVMe 或企业级 SSD 提升随机 IOPS;避免使用共享低速盘的 VPS 在高负载下出现抖动。
  • 合理选择文件系统与挂载选项(例如 ext4 的 discard、noatime 设置或 XFS 的日志策略)。
  • 数据库层面使用连接池、读写分离、索引优化以减少磁盘访问。
  • 监测并优化 RAID、LVM 层的队列深度,使用 fio 测试不同 block size 下的吞吐与 IOPS。

应用层优化与架构建议

网络与系统优化外,还需从应用层着手:

  • HTTP 优化:使用 Nginx 做反向代理,开启 keepalive、gzip/ Brotli、HTTP/2 或 HTTP/3(QUIC)以降低延迟与提升并发。
  • TLS 优化:开启 TLS 1.3、启用 Session Resumption、OCSP Stapling,减少握手时间。
  • 缓存策略:在服务器端使用 Redis/Memcached 做热点缓存,结合 CDN 做静态内容分发,减轻吉隆坡服务器压力。
  • 分布式部署:对全球用户采用多点部署(香港VPS/美国VPS/新加坡服务器/日本服务器/韩国服务器 等)并结合智能 DNS,实现就近访问与故障隔离。
  • 限流与熔断:在高并发时保护后端资源,保证稳定性。

与其他地区服务器的比较

选择吉隆坡服务器时通常会对比香港服务器、新加坡服务器、日本服务器、韩国服务器甚至美国服务器。关键比较维度:

  • 延迟:对东南亚用户,吉隆坡与新加坡互为近邻,延迟通常最低;香港、日本、韩国稍高;美国服务器对 SEA 用户延迟最高。
  • 带宽与出口:香港与新加坡的国际带宽资源通常更充足,适合大量国际流量;吉隆坡适合区域性业务,成本相对较优。
  • 互联与对等:香港/新加坡的 IX 更成熟,但吉隆坡也在改善国际海缆接入,选择提供良好对等关系的机房尤为重要。
  • 成本与合规:美国服务器适合北美用户与合规需求,但带宽成本与延迟劣势明显;香港VPS 与美国VPS 在灵活性与成本上各有特点。

选购吉隆坡服务器的实用建议

选购时请关注以下要点:

  • 端口速率与计费模型:确认是否为 1Gbps/10Gbps 实际端口,带宽计费是固定保底、突发(burstable)还是按用量计费。
  • 网络互联与 Peering:询问机房是否直连主要运营商与区域 IX,查看是否有对中国、香港或新加坡的优质通路。
  • DDoS 与安全:确认是否含基础 DDoS 防护以及可选的增强防护方案。
  • 硬件与 I/O 规格:选择 NVMe、企业盘或专用物理服务器避免 VPS 的“邻居噪音”。
  • SLA 与运维支持:关注带宽/网络和硬件的 SLA,是否提供 24/7 支持和快速故障响应。
  • 测试通路:购买前做试用,使用 iperf3、mtr、ping 测试从目标用户网络到服务器的真实表现。

实战优化清单(可复制执行)

  • 在目标实例上跑 iperf3(TCP 与 UDP)测带宽极限并记录高峰与低谷表现。
  • 使用 mtr 连续 5 分钟检查丢包分布,定位跳点异常。
  • 在 Linux 上应用上述 sysctl 调优,重启服务并复测吞吐。
  • 启用 BBR 并通过 iperf3 对比启用前后的吞吐与延迟。
  • 部署 Nginx + Keepalive + gzip + HTTP/2,测试首字节时间(TTFB)改进。
  • 设置 CDN(对于静态大文件)并在 CDN 与原站之间监控回源带宽。

总结:何时选择吉隆坡服务器

如果你的主要用户群在马来西亚或整个东南亚地区,且需要较低延迟与合理成本的落地服务器,吉隆坡服务器是一个均衡的选择。与香港服务器、新加坡服务器及日本服务器相比,吉隆坡在区域覆盖与成本上常具优势;若目标是全球覆盖或对北美用户有大量访问,则需结合美国服务器或海外服务器多点部署。技术上,通过内核级网络参数优化(如 BBR)、合理的 I/O 选型(NVMe/企业盘)、以及应用层的缓存与 CDN 策略,可以在吉隆坡节点实现接近最佳的响应和吞吐表现。

若需进一步对比不同带宽计费模式、机房互联情况或获得可试用的吉隆坡实例,建议先进行短期测试并基于 iperf3/mtr 等数据评估后再扩容。更多关于马来西亚服务器的产品信息与可用配置请参考:马来西亚服务器

THE END